As an aggressive player, I have learned a few valuable lessons while wagering over the decades. Whether you are partial to play at the ‘bricks and mortar’ casinos or the numerous internet casinos. Here are my all important rules of betting, most of which might be considered clear thinking, but if accepted they will assist you in going a long way to departing with money in your account.

Rule one: Go into a casino with a set figure that you are ready and can afford to bet – How much would it cost for a night out on food, alcoholic beverages, cover fees and tips? This is a good number to use.

Rule two: Don’t carry your debit card with you – or any way of drawing money out. Do not concern yourself about cash for the cab if you burn all your cash; most taxi drivers, particularly the taxis hailed through casinos, will drive you to your abode and will be more than happy to wait for the cash when you get back.

Rule 3: Stay to your predetermined cap. I constantly think of what I’d want to buy should I win. The last time I went, I determined I would really would love to purchase a new Media Player which retailed at $400, so that was my set cutoff. As soon as I surpassed that sum, I walked away. Just walk away. Even if Mystic Megan herself tells you the upcoming number for the roulette wheel, ignore her and say goodbye. Head out safe in the knowledge that you will be proceeding into the mall and getting a nice new toy!
